Basic Properties of Carbon Black
Carbon black is a type of fine carbon particle produced by the incomplete combustion or pyrolysis of organic matter. It possesses a very high specific surface area, a small particle size, and excellent dispersibility. These properties make it one of the most commonly used black pigments in the ink industry. A wide variety of carbon blacks are available, depending on the production process, particle size, and surface area, to meet diverse ink requirements.
Functions of Carbon Black in Ink
In ink formulations, carbon black primarily performs the following functions:
1. Improving Blackness and Tinting Strength
One of the most prominent functions of carbon black is to enhance the blackness and tinting strength of inks. Due to the structural characteristics of carbon black particles, they effectively absorb light, resulting in a deep, rich black color. Different types of carbon black can adjust the color saturation and gloss of inks, providing rich color effects for printed products.
2. Improved Lightfastness and Weatherability
Carbon black has excellent lightfastness, effectively preventing ink from fading or aging in sunlight. For printed products exposed to outdoor conditions for extended periods, such as billboards and packaging, carbon black is crucial in improving the lightfastness and weatherability of inks. This property ensures that printed products retain their vibrant colors despite varying climate conditions.
3. Enhanced Adhesion
Carbon black’s fine particles interact well with other ink components, such as resins and solvents, effectively improving ink adhesion. This allows the ink to be evenly applied and firmly adhere to various substrates, such as paper, plastic, and metal, during the printing process, resulting in more stable and durable prints.
4. Improved Abrasion Resistance
The addition of carbon black to inks increases the hardness and abrasion resistance of the ink layer. This makes the printed surface less susceptible to damage from prolonged use or friction. Especially in the packaging, electronics, and automotive sectors, carbon black’s abrasion resistance can significantly extend the product’s lifespan.
5. Providing Conductivity
Certain types of carbon black, such as surface-treated conductive carbon black, exhibit excellent conductivity. In the electronics and electrical fields, carbon black is used in applications such as printed circuits, touch screens, and electronic labels. Carbon black’s conductivity ensures the proper functioning of electronic products and is a key material for modern electronic functionality.
Applications of Carbon Black in Different Types of Inks
The usage and function of carbon black vary depending on the ink type.
1. Offset inks
Offset inks are widely used in printing newspapers, books, and packaging. Carbon black is primarily used in offset inks to:
- Increase black depth and tinting strength, resulting in clear, vibrant prints;
- Improve ink adhesion to paper, ensuring the integrity of images and text during printing;
- Increase ink abrasion resistance, making printed products more durable.
2. Water-Based Inks
Water-based inks are environmentally friendly and low-odor, making them suitable for food packaging and environmentally friendly printing. Carbon black plays the following roles in water-based inks:
- Provides a rich black color and uniform dispersion;
- Improves ink lightfastness, ensuring color stability over long-term use;
- Combines with water-based resins to enhance ink adhesion and ensure clear print quality.
3. Ultraviolet (UV) Inks
UV inks are primarily used in labels, packaging, and high-precision printing, characterized by their rapid curing. Carbon black is used in UV inks for the following reasons:
- Improving black color strength and gloss of the printed layer;
- Assisting in rapid ink curing, improving production efficiency;
- Enhancing abrasion and light resistance, ensuring longer-lasting printed products.
